AbiWidget: Improve AbiWidget

Do less work in the Abi widget by ignoring intermediate states. Blocking signals
did not work well enough:-)

This makes the Abi widget more robust since a lot of useless state changes are
avoided. It also reduces the number of abiChanged signal emissions from this
widget, avoiding potentially costly updates in its users.
